
1754
The year 1754 was a significant period marked by political and territorial conflicts, most notably the start of the French and Indian War in North America. This war was part of a larger global struggle between Britain and France for influence and land. In North America, it involved fighting over control of the Ohio Valley and surrounding regions. The conflict influenced the future of North American borders and relationships between European powers and Native American tribes. Additionally, 1754 saw developments in culture, science, and politics across the world, reflecting a time of change and expansion.
